Hi all,

I followed the  http://trac.osgeo.org/fusion/ticket/115 ticket about the
"Update to new Js"  but I have the error Jx.aPixel is undefined.

After having downloaded the Here what I did:
1 - renamed "jx" folder to "old_jx"
2 - copied all .JS files and the a_pixel.png file into /fusion/lib
3 - copied the a_pixel.png file into /fusion/lib
4 - copied the "themes" folder into /fusion/templates
5 - modified the fusion.jx file (*) like this :

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
        ...
        //at line 42:
        if (Fusion.useCompressed) {
        Fusion.coreScripts = ['lib/OpenLayers/OpenLayersCompressed.js',
                                                'lib/jxlib.js', // <== MODIFIED
                                                'lib/fusion-compressed.js',
                                                'lib/excanvas/excanvas-compressed.js'];
        } else {
        Fusion.coreScripts = ['lib/OpenLayers/OpenLayers.js',
                                                'lib/jxlib.uncompressed.js', // <== MODIFIED
                                                'lib/excanvas/excanvas-compressed.js',
                                                'lib/utils.js',
                                                'lib/Error.js',
                                                'lib/ApplicationDefinition.js',
                                                'lib/MGBroker.js',
                                                'lib/Widget.js',
                                                'lib/ButtonBase.js',
                                                'lib/MenuBase.js',
                                                'lib/ButtonTool.js',
                                                'lib/CanvasTool.js',
                                                'lib/ClickTool.js',
                                                'lib/RectTool.js',
                                                'lib/Map.js',
                                                'lib/Search.js',
                                                'text/en/strings.json'];
        }
        ...
       
        //at line 93:
        Jx.baseURL = gszFusionURL + 'lib/'; // <== 'jx/' changed to 'lib/'
        ...
       

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

I tried to :
- copy the "themes" content into /fusion/templates (instead of 4)
- copy the a_pixel.png into every "images" directories I found (instead of
3)

Somebody has an idea of what I did wrong?

Thanks in advance for your help.

PS: My OSMG version is 2.0.2.3011.

You can't update Jx independently for an existing version of Fusion  
for this release ... the Jx API has changed and the development (soon  
to be 2.0) version of Fusion has been altered to accommodate the  
changes.  Existing Fusion versions will not work with the new Jx.

We are getting very close to finishing up the major changes we needed  
to make for version 2.0 and will be releasing a beta version "real  
soon now".

If you are brave, you can follow the instructions in the wiki for  
getting the SVN version of Fusion from trunk and get the new MapGuide  
templates from the MapGuide SVN.  If not, then please wait a week or  
two and we will ship a beta for MapGuide that includes everything you  
need.
